Nomenclature

The following information is derived from Barry Bolton's Online Catalogue of the Ants of the World.

  • queenslandensis. Ponera queenslandensis Forel, 1900b: 61 (w.q.) AUSTRALIA. Combination in Hypoponera: Taylor, 1967a: 12.
